Latest Patents: Kuo's most recent patent, titled "Method for preparing precursor used for labeling hepatocyte receptor and containing trisaccharide and DTPA ligand," introduces a novel approach for synthesizing a precursor that plays a crucial role in labeling hepatocyte receptors. This innovative method utilizes a bifunctional structure that incorporates both trisaccharide and DTPA ligand. The process involves the use of silica gel columns and Reverse phase-18 (RP-18) columns for purification, significantly reducing both the purification time and associated costs. Furthermore, this method employs diethyl ether to facilitate the precipitation of products and efficiently remove part of the coupling reagent, enhancing the overall yield of the trisaccharide structure.
